Background and Compliance Requirements
- Comprehensive background check covering all locations lived/worked in the past 7 years, including:
- SSN Trace
- County, State, Nationwide Criminal Search
- Sex Offender Search
- Education Verification
- PA PATCH (Pennsylvania State Police Search)
- EPLS/GSA/SAM and HHS/OIG checks required upon hire.
- Pennsylvania Department of Human Services fingerprint clearance required within 90 days of start.
- Pennsylvania Child Abuse Search required within 90 days of start.
- Pennsylvania Medicheck Search required within 30 days of start.
- PA PATCH Search Results required within 90 days of start.
